Hey all

When I click on a link to a website or type in a web
address, I sometimes get sent to this site :
http://www.perfectnav.com/index.cfm?
action=lookup&pc=pnkz&arg=DNS&Keywords=

Anyone know why and how I can fix it?

First eliminate any scumware.
See
Dealing with Unwanted Spyware, Parasites, Toolbars and Search Engines
http://mvps.org/winhelp2002/unwanted.htm

Note that AdAware and SpyBot S & D will each catch some things the other
won't. Also, each need to be updated before every use, even when just
downloaded. There's also a lot more to do than just those two programs.

If trying everything at that site does not fix the problem please post back
in the same thread.
